Product reviews:
Rudolf
2026-01-08 iphone XS Max
Mahindra launches new electric three mahindra three wheeler bike
mahindra three wheeler bike
Magee
2026-01-12 iphone SE
Launch 3 Peugeot Scooters in India mahindra three wheeler bike
mahindra three wheeler bike
Mahindra UDO Price in India, Images mahindra three wheeler bike
mahindra three wheeler bike